Outside Assessment Tips



Routinely checking the exterior of your roofing system is important for preserving its stability and recognizing potential damage early. Beginning by analyzing the roof shingles-- seek any kind of missing, split, or curling shingles, as these can be signs of roofing system damage.


Inspect the seamless gutters for granules from the roof shingles, as extreme granule loss may indicate aging or weathering. Focus on the flashing around vents, chimneys, and skylights, guaranteeing they're snugly sealed and free of splits.

Look for signs of moss, algae, or mold growth, as these can result in roofing damage if not resolved without delay. Additionally, evaluate the fascia and soffits for any kind of water discolorations or rot, which could signal water damages.

Last but not least, assess the overall problem of your roof covering from the ground, trying to find any drooping locations or visible dips. By carrying out these exterior assessments regularly, you can catch roofing system damage early and prevent it from becoming a significant problem.

Interior Warning



When evaluating your roof for possible damages, don't forget the value of inspecting the interior of your home. Interior red flags can typically be early indicators of roof covering issues that need focus.

Beginning by analyzing your ceilings for any kind of water stains or staining, as these could indicate a leak in the roofing system. One more key area to evaluate is the attic room, where indicators of water damages, mold and mildew, or mold may indicate a roof problem.

Pay attention to any kind of mildewy smells or an obvious boost in moisture levels, as these can also be indicators of water intrusion from a harmed roof. Additionally, sagging locations in the ceiling or walls must be taken seriously, as they could be a result of water damage deteriorating the framework.

If you observe any of these indoor warnings, it's vital to have a professional contractor assess the situation immediately to prevent further damages and expensive repair work.
